Follansbee, W.Va.-based Follansbee Steel—owned by
Steubenville, Ohio-based Louis Berkman Co.—and Follansbee
Steel's Sheet Metal Specialty Division recently closed because of
"sustained unfavorable business conditions." The closure affected
36 workers. Both companies will work closely with its customers to
minimize the closure's effects.
Mark Robinson, Follansbee Steel's executive vice president and
general manager, says the shutdown process will be gradual, giving
the company time to test the investor market. He says Louis Berkman
will try to make Follansbee Steel attractive to potential buyers,
but it must act quickly.
